What’s the advantage of learning French?

Here are many advantages to learning French, as it is a widely spoken language with a rich cultural heritage. Some of the benefits of learning French include the following:

  1. Communication:

    French is spoken by over 300 million people worldwide, making it the fifth most spoken language in terms of native speakers.By learning French, you’ll be able to communicate with a significant portion of the world’s population and travel more easily to French-speaking countries.

  1. Cultural enrichment

    : Learning French will allow you to learn about and appreciate the diverse cultures of French-speaking countries. You’ll be able to enjoy their literature, music, art, and film in their original language, and you’ll be able to engage with their customs and traditions on a deeper level.

  2. Career advancement

    : Many businesses and organizations have a presence in French-speaking countries, and knowing French can give you a competitive edge in the job market. It can also open up translation, interpretation, and education job opportunities.

  3. Brain benefits:

    Learning a second language has been shown to have numerous cognitive benefits, including improved memory, problem-solving skills, and multitasking abilities.

  4. Personal fulfillment

    : Learning a new language is a rewarding experience that can broaden your horizons and give you a sense of accomplishment. It can also be a fun and enjoyable hobby that allows you to connect with others and expand your social circle.

The best app for free French lesson

There are many apps available that offer free French lessons. Some of the top options include:

  1. Duolingo: This popular language-learning app offers interactive lessons and games to help you learn French at your own pace. It’s a great option for beginners, as it starts with the basics and gradually increases in difficulty.
  2. Rosetta Stone: This well-known language learning program offers a comprehensive and immersive approach to learning French. It includes interactive lessons, speech recognition technology, and real-life scenarios to help you practice your skills.
  3. French Translator & Dictionary: This app offers a wide range of tools for learning French, including a dictionary, verb conjugator, and pronunciation guide. It’s a great resource for building your vocabulary and improving your grammar.
  4. HelloTalk: This app connects you with native French speakers willing to practice their language skills with you. You can exchange messages and have conversations with other learners and native speakers, which is a great way to practice your listening and speaking skills.

Ultimately, the best app for you will depend on your learning style and goals. Try out a few options to see which works best for you.

Online courses for free French lesson

There are many online courses available that offer free French lesson. Some of the top options include:

  1. Duolingo: This popular language-learning platform offers interactive lessons and games to help you learn French at your own pace. It’s a great option for beginners, as it starts with the basics and gradually increases in difficulty.
  2. Babbel: This online language learning course offers structured lessons and a variety of learning materials, including audio exercises, grammar explanations, and vocabulary lists. It’s a good option for those who prefer a more structured approach to learning.
  3. Busuu: This language learning platform offers interactive lessons, practice exercises, and feedback from native French speakers. It also includes a feature allowing you to practice speaking skills with a virtual conversation partner.
  4. Frenchpod101: This online course offers a range of French lessons in the form of video and audio lessons, as well as vocabulary lists and grammar explanations. It also includes cultural notes and real-life conversations to help you practice your listening and speaking skills.

These are just a few examples of the many online courses available for learning French. It’s a good idea to explore a few different options to find the one that works best for you.

Websites offering free French lesson

There are many websites available that offer free French lessons. Some of the top options include:

  1. BBC Languages: This website offers a range of French lessons for beginners and more advanced learners. It includes audio and video lessons, interactive exercises and cultural notes.
  2. French Together: This website offers a variety of French lessons and resources, including grammar explanations, vocabulary lists, and listening exercises. It also includes a forum to connect with other learners and native speakers.
  3. Study With French: This website offers a range of French lessons for all levels, including grammar explanations, vocabulary lists, and audio exercises. It also includes cultural notes and real-life conversations to help you practice your listening and speaking skills.
  4. French Language Tips: This website offers a range of French lessons and resources, including grammar explanations, vocabulary lists, and audio exercises. It also includes cultural notes and tips for learning French effectively.

These are just a few examples of the many websites available for learning French. It’s a good idea to explore a few different options to find the one that works best for you.
